What matters most with a fan hoodie?

Fabric, construction, and how the motif is applied. For fabric, weight decides the use case: lighter qualities work as a transitional piece, heavier ones with a brushed inside almost replace a jacket in fall. Cotton wears soft, blended fabrics hold shape and color through many washes. For construction, it's worth checking the cuffs, hood lining, and drawstrings – that's where the favorite piece separates from the letdown. And for the motif: print offers surface area and color gradients, embroidery offers texture and durability. Which technique was used and how to care for it is on the product page – along with the measurements, which are more reliable than any guess in your head.

What's the difference between a hoodie and a sweatshirt?

The hood. The sweatshirt is the crew-neck classic and sits less bulky under jackets; the hoodie brings a hood and usually a kangaroo pocket along. Both share the same materials and motif worlds – so the choice is a style question, not a fandom one.

How do I wash a printed hoodie properly?

Inside out, at 30°C, no dryer – and don't iron directly on the print. Pull the drawstrings tight or remove them beforehand so nothing tangles. That way color and shape outlast most TV show seasons.

Do fan hoodies run true to size?

That depends on the cut of the specific item – everything from classic straight cuts to oversize is represented. Reliable are the measurements on the product page; if you're torn between two sizes and like it cozier, go with the bigger one.
